Spawn Mechanics: When and How Bosses Appear

World Bosses in VvW spawn through two mechanisms: a daily scheduled window and a community goal trigger. Understanding both is essential for positioning yourself to participate.

The scheduled window opens daily at 12:00 UTC. At this point, each World Boss type has a random spawn chance — Mini Bosses have the highest chance, World Bosses moderate, and Apex Bosses the lowest. The actual spawn is not guaranteed at 12:00; the chance is evaluated at that time, and the boss appears in its designated region if the roll succeeds. On days when no boss spawns from the random check, the community goal threshold can trigger one instead.

The community goal tracker (visible on the main map interface) accumulates a shared counter every time players complete dungeons, win PvP fights, and complete daily missions. When this counter reaches a threshold reset at midnight UTC, a guaranteed World Boss spawn is triggered at the next 12:00 UTC window regardless of the random roll. Active server days with high player engagement reliably produce boss spawns through this mechanism.

SPAWN NOTIFICATION

Enable World Boss spawn notifications in your account settings (Settings → Alerts). You will receive an in-game notification when a boss spawns. Missing the first 30 minutes of a boss fight significantly reduces your reward tier.

Three Boss Types Explained

Not all World Bosses are equal. VvW has three distinct boss tiers, each with different HP pools, player caps, and reward profiles:

Mini Boss

The most frequently spawning boss type. Mini Bosses are designed as accessible entry points — lower HP, moderate rewards, and a relatively forgiving timer. They are ideal for players who are new to boss mechanics or who are testing a new DPS build. The companion gear drop rate for Mini Bosses is 8% per kill participation.

World Boss

The standard World Boss tier. Requires meaningful coordination among participants for efficient kills. Companion gear drop rate is 12% per kill participation, and the Raid Marks currency rewards are substantially higher than Mini Boss encounters. World Bosses are the primary target for mid-to-endgame players.

Apex Boss

The rarest and most powerful boss type. Apex Bosses have enormous HP pools and require large groups of well-geared players to kill before the timer expires. The companion gear drop rate is 18%, and the Raid Marks rewards are the highest available from any repeatable PvE content. An Apex Boss kill is a server event — the entire active player base is aware of and competing over Apex Boss encounters.

Boss Reference Table

Boss Type HP Pool Max Participants Companion Drop % Reward Tier
Mini Boss500,00025 players8%Standard
World Boss2,500,00075 players12%Enhanced
Apex Boss8,000,000150 players18%Apex (highest)

Shared HP Pool: How It Works

World Boss HP is stored as a shared value — every attack from every participant reduces the same pool. This creates a genuinely collaborative PvE environment: every player who deals damage is contributing to the kill, and no player is wasting effort because "someone else already killed it."

The shared HP system also creates the leaderboard dynamic. Because everyone is attacking the same pool, the game tracks each player's total damage contribution against the boss's maximum HP. This percentage — your share of total boss HP removed — determines your leaderboard position and reward tier.

Practically, this means that arriving early and dealing consistent damage throughout the fight is more important than any single high-damage burst. Players who log in when the boss is at 20% HP will always score lower than players who were present for the full fight, regardless of their individual damage output efficiency.

The Damage Leaderboard and Reward Tiers

The damage leaderboard displays every participating player's total damage contribution in descending order. Reward tiers are assigned based on leaderboard position at the time the boss is killed:

  • Top 3 contributors — Maximum reward cache: highest Raid Marks yield, guaranteed rare item, highest companion drop chance.
  • Top 10 contributors — Enhanced reward cache: high Raid Marks yield, chance at rare item, standard companion drop chance.
  • Top 25% of participants — Standard reward cache: base Raid Marks, standard loot table.
  • All other participants — Participation reward: small Raid Marks bonus, basic loot table.

The difference between Top 3 and participation reward is substantial. Serious World Boss players structure their builds and timing specifically to compete for top leaderboard positions consistently.

Optimal Attack Timing

The first 30 minutes of a boss encounter are the most valuable for leaderboard positioning. During this window, the boss is at full HP — every hit you land represents a larger percentage of total boss HP than hits landed at lower HP values (in absolute terms they are equal, but relative to final total, early damage is proportionally significant when boss HP is distributed across many attackers).

More practically: the most organized, highest-DPS players log in immediately at boss spawn. If you arrive 45 minutes into a fight that lasted 60 minutes, you are competing against players who have had 45 minutes of head start on the leaderboard. There is no catch-up mechanic — arrive early or accept a lower reward tier.

LATE ARRIVAL REALITY

Arriving late to a World Boss fight is always worse than missing it entirely from a Raid Marks efficiency standpoint. A participation reward from a fight you spent 10 minutes in is poor value compared to the time invested. Prioritize early arrival or skip entirely and catch the next spawn.

Best Build for World Boss DPS

World Boss encounters favor STR-based burst builds over sustained damage or defensive configurations. The reasoning is timing: you have a finite window to deal maximum damage before the boss dies, and builds that front-load damage into opening attacks score higher on the leaderboard than builds that sustain moderate damage over longer encounters.

Optimal World Boss build principles:

  • Maximize STR — Primary damage stat for burst builds. Do not compromise STR for survivability stats; World Boss encounters do not require you to tank damage.
  • Attack speed items — More attacks in the opening window means more total damage registered before the boss dies. Stack attack speed gear for boss encounters.
  • Crit-focused skills — Critical hit skills provide disproportionate leaderboard gains. A critical hit on a World Boss contributes double the leaderboard percentage of a normal hit.
  • Avoid defensive investment — VIT, armor, and resistances waste stat budget in a fight where survival is not the challenge. Respec toward offense before major boss encounters.

Companion Synergies for Boss Fights

Companions with offensive synergy abilities that trigger on combat start provide an amplified benefit in boss fights, since you want maximum front-loaded damage. Look for companions with:

  • Opening attack multipliers (companions that boost your first 3-5 attacks of a combat encounter).
  • Crit rate aura bonuses (passive companions that increase your critical hit chance during extended fights).
  • STR scaling companions whose bonus scales with your primary stat rather than a flat value.

Avoid companion builds oriented around defensive mitigation or healing — these abilities have no value against a World Boss where your HP is not meaningfully threatened if you have any reasonable character development.

Raid Marks Currency and Endgame Vendor

Raid Marks are the exclusive currency earned from World Boss participation. They are earned from every boss encounter regardless of leaderboard position, with higher positions earning more. Raid Marks do not expire between seasons and accumulate across all boss encounters you participate in.

The Raid Marks endgame vendor offers items that are not obtainable through any other game system — endgame crafting blueprints, special companion equipment, and cosmetic items exclusive to the World Boss reward track. The vendor refreshes a portion of its stock each season, ensuring there is always something new to work toward.

For players who prioritize endgame progression, consistent World Boss participation is not optional — it is one of the few pathways to the vendor's exclusive item tier. A player who participates in 20 boss encounters per month, even at standard participation tier, will accumulate enough Raid Marks to access mid-tier vendor items within a few months.
